BACKGROUND: The interaction of our immune system with breast cancer (BC) cells prompted the investigation of tumor-infiltrating lymphocytes (TILs) and targeted, tumor antigen-specific immunotherapy. OBJECTIVES: Correlation between TILs and pathological complete response (pCR) after neoadjuvant systemic therapy (NACT). Tumor-specific antigens (TSAs) in HER2+ and triple negative BC and establishment of TSA-specific therapies within the interdisciplinary TILGen study. METHODS: Illustration of the TILGen study design. Assessment of TILs and correlation with pCR within this BC study. RESULTS: pCR was achieved in 38.4% (56/146) and associated with estrogen receptor/progesterone receptor negative (ER-/PR-) and HER2+ tumors. Lymphocytic predominant BC (LPBC) was found in 16.4% (24/146), particularly in ER-/PR- (ER-: 27.3% vs. ER+: 9.9%, PR-: 22.3% vs. PR+: 8.2%), large, and poorly differentiated BC. TILs were significantly correlated with pCR in multivariate analysis. In LPBC, pCR was achieved in 66.7%, whereas it was 32.8% in non-LPBC. CONCLUSIONS: First results confirm the influence of the human immune system on the response to NACT in HER2+ and triple negative BC. TSA-specific immunotherapy might improve the outcome in BC patients but there is an urgent need for comprehensive studies to further investigate this issue.

INTRODUCTION: The potential of sonography in the examination of lung tissue is extremely limited by the air-filled alveoles of the lung. Only in special circumstances like pleural adhesion lesions, atelectasis or pneumonia can lung tissue be visualized by B-mode sonography. Real-time elastography was primarily applied to detect and visualize pulmonary lesions. METHODS AND PATIENTS: 8 patients with a total of 18 histologically proven metastases of the lung were included. All pulmonary lesions were detected by computed tomography. Sonographic examination was performed with a 7.5 MHz linear transducer (Acuson Antares premium edition, Siemens, Erlangen, Germany), including B-mode and real-time elastography (RTE). The mean distance between pleura and the lesions ranged from 0 to 2.5 cm. Two lesions were located in the upper right lobe, eleven lesions in the lower right and five in the lower left lobe. RESULTS: RTE was able to detect and visualize all 18 pulmonary lesions in contrast to B-mode. The size and distance of the lesions from the pleura correlated with the CT findings. CONCLUSION: In contrast to B-mode sonography, RTE is able to detect and visualize peripheral, non-pleural adherent pulmonary lesions.

PURPOSE: The aim of this study was to evaluate the quality standard of the nationwide breast ultrasound training program of the German Society of Ultrasound in Medicine (DEGUM) through objective parameters. MATERIALS AND METHODS: 10 quality criteria, based on the recommendations of The National Association of Statutory Health Insurance Physicians (KBV), were defined for this study. All training units of the DEGUM received a questionnaire. The questionnaires and training material were analyzed. RESULTS: All units met the required criteria pertaining to the trainer's qualification, duration per training course and the maximum number of participants per ultrasound machine. Only 1 course did not fulfill the required 50 % practical training time. The requirements to participate in the graduate course (200 self-made and documented cases) were not clearly conceived and a defined training log could be improved. CONCLUSION: DEGUM breast ultrasound training offers trainees a high level of education based on the requirements of the KBV. Despite the high quality of training, the content of course announcements could be improved and an official and structured educational index could be meaningful.

Mammography is the central diagnostic method for clinical diagnostics of breast cancer and the breast cancer screening program. In the clinical routine complementary methods, such as ultrasound, tomosynthesis and optional magnetic resonance imaging (MRI) are already combined for the diagnostic procedure. Future developments will utilize investigative procedures either as a hybrid (combination of several different imaging modalities in one instrument) or as a fusion method (the technical fusion of two or more of these methods) to implement fusion imaging into diagnostic algorithms. For screening there are reasonable hypotheses to aim for studies that individualize the diagnostic process within the screening procedure. Individual breast cancer risk prediction and individualized knowledge about sensitivity and specificity for certain diagnostic methods could be tested. The clinical implementation of these algorithms is not yet in sight.

PURPOSE: Elastography is a new ultrasonographic method that has been examined as a diagnostic tool for breast lesions. This study was intended to create and define new elastographic criteria allowing assessment of whether breast lesions are malignant or benign. MATERIALS AND METHODS: 217 patients with a total of 245 breast lesions of unknown malignancy underwent ultrasound examination. The new eSie Touch Elasticity Imaging technology (Siemens, Erlangen, Germany) was used with a 10-MHz linear transducer (Acuson Antares). Lesions were examined using B-mode and real-time elastography (RTE). Each lesion was histologically assessed by core biopsy. Five RTE characteristics were examined: elasticity proportion (EP), different location on RTE in comparison with B-mode (MV), different contrast patterns (SOS), dorsal lesion limitation visibility and different size on RTE in comparison with B-mode. RESULTS: 54 malignant lesions (54 %) appeared inelastic, in contrast to the benign control group (34.5 %; P = 0.001). A completely elastic pattern was visible in 10 malignant (10 %) and 39 benign lesions (26.9 %). MV was identified in 23 cases, with 22 of the lesions being malignant and one benign. The SOS was negative in 89 malignant lesions (89 %) and positive in 100 benign lesions. The dorsal lesion limitation was visible on RTE without B-mode in 88 malignant lesions (88 %) and 27 benign lesions (18.6 %). The size was assessed as larger in 45 malignant lesions (45 %) and seven benign lesions (4.8 %). CONCLUSION: SOS and a larger tumor size on RTE are specific characteristics of malignant breast lesions. EP, MV and distal mass border are further helpful signs to assess the malignancy of tumors.

PURPOSE: Phyllodes tumors (PT) are a rare entity accounting for less than 1 % of all breast lesions. They have a malignancy rate of 25-30%. Differentiation from benign fibroadenomas is difficult using ultrasound, mammogram and MRI. The elastic characteristics of both tumors were examined using real-time elastography (RTE) to find specific patterns that make differentiation possible. MATERIALS AND METHODS: From February 2007 to May 2009, a total of 620 women were examined by RTE. Histological diagnosis was achieved using core needle biopsy. 123 of the lesions were fibroadenomas, 8 were phyllodes tumors. All patients underwent mammography and ultrasound followed by RTE. Sonography was performed by Acuson Antares, Premium Edition® (Siemens, Erlangen, Germany) with a 7 and 10 MHz transducer. RESULTS: All phyllodes tumors had a similar elastic pattern with an elastic center and inelastic outer limits, referred to as the "ring sign". It was found in 5% of all fibroadenomas. CONCLUSION: RTE provides a specific elastic pattern, which is sufficient for differentiating between a fibroadenoma and a phyllodes tumor. Therefore, the detection of the most suspicious lesion in women with the coexistence of multiple fibroadenomas and phyllodes tumors seems easier.

PURPOSE: The aim of this retrospective clinical study was to compare the diagnostic accuracy of the novel 50 µm FFDM (full-field digital mammography) system (DR) with an established 70 µm system (DR) in the differential diagnosis between benign and malignant clusters of microcalcification (n=50) (BI-RADS™ classification 4/5) and to assess the possible incremental value of the 50 µm pixel-pitch on specificity. MATERIAL AND METHODS: From March 2009 to September 2009, 50 patients underwent full-field digital mammography (FFDM) (detector resolution 70 µm) (Novation, Siemens, Erlangen, Germany). As there were suspicious signs of microcalcification classified with BI-RADS™ 4/5 after diagnosis and preoperative wire localization, control images were made with the new FFDM system (detector: resolution 50 µm) (Amulet, Fujifilm, Tokyo, Japan) with the same exposure parameters. The diagnosis was determined after the operation by five radiologists with different experience in digital mammography from randomly distributed mediolateral views (monitor reading) whose results were correlated with the final histology of all lesions. RESULTS: Histopathology revealed 19 benign and 31 malignant lesions in 50 patients after open biopsy. The results of the five readers showed a higher sensitivity of the new FFDM system (80.0%) in the ability to recognize malignant microcalcification in comparison to the established system (74.8%). The specificity (75.8 versus 71.6%) was slightly higher for the new system but these results were not statistically significant (p<0.001). Considering the diagnostic accuracy, the new system (detector: resolution 50 µm) was also slightly superior to the well-known system (detector: resolution 70 µm) (80.1% versus 76.4%). CONCLUSIONS: Our study has shown that the new full-field digital mammography system using the novel detector compared with the already established FFDM system with respect to the assessment of microcalcification is at least equivalent.

PURPOSE: The article describes an experimental phantom study of a system for digital full field mammography with a new digital detector with a double plate of pure selenium. MATERIALS AND METHODS: The experiments were carried out with the new full field digital mammography system Amulet from FujiFilm. This system has a new detector (18×24 cm(2)) on the basis of highly purified amorphous selenium (a-Se) with a pixel size of 50 µm. The x-rays are converted into electric signals in the first plate which are read into the second plate with the help of an optical switch and demonstrated in the form of an image. In this way a better pixel size/volume and signal-to-noise ratio should be achieved. The object of the investigation was the Wisconsin Mammographic Random Phantom, Model 152 A (Technical Performance Mo/Mo, 28 kV, 100 mAs). Five investigators with different experiences in mammography each received three images on a monitor with different random positions of the simulated lesions in the phantom for assessment. The detection rates were compared under the same conditions with the results of two other full field digital mammography systems. RESULTS: The median detection rate for all images and investigators for the new doubled plated a-Se detector with optical switch was 98.7%. For both other systems with a-Si or and a-Se detectors the detection rate was 89.8% or 97.3%, respectively. There were no significant differences in the detection rate of the simulated breast lesions for all three systems considering the interobserver and intraobserver variation. CONCLUSION: The first phantom study for the detection of simulated breast lesions with the new full field digital mammography system Amulet demonstrates equivalent results with the other systems used in the clinical routine. The trend towards superiority of the new system has to be confirmed in further clinical studies.

The updated 2008 German Guideline for Early Detection of Breast Cancer provides evidence-based and consensus-based recommendations of the knowledge gained by the German Society for Surgery and the German Society of Plastic, Aesthetic, and Reconstructive Surgeons together with 29 professional societies, associations, and nonmedical organizations. The guideline is meant to assist physicians, healthy women, and patients in medical decisions with recommendations regarding the diagnostic chain in early detection of breast cancer. In addition to these recommendations, the guideline also includes descriptions of quality assurance for resources, procedures, outcomes, and evaluation using a set of quality indicators. It updates the previous version from 2003. The guideline's recommendations are presented. They are described in detail in the full publication (in German) Geburtsh Frauenh 2008; 68:251-261. Mammography is the most effective method for breast cancer screening available today. However, the low positive predictive value of breast biopsy resulting from mammogram interpretation leads to approximately 70% unnecessary biopsies with benign outcomes. To reduce the high number of unnecessary breast biopsies, several computer-aided diagnosis (CAD) systems have been proposed in the last several years. These systems help physicians in their decision to perform a breast biopsy on a suspicious lesion seen in a mammogram or to perform a short term follow-up examination instead. We present two novel CAD approaches that both emphasize an intelligible decision process to predict breast biopsy outcomes from BI-RADS findings. An intelligible reasoning process is an important requirement for the acceptance of CAD systems by physicians. The first approach induces a global model based on decison-tree learning. The second approach is based on case-based reasoning and applies an entropic similarity measure. We have evaluated the performance of both CAD approaches on two large publicly available mammography reference databases using receiver operating characteristic (ROC) analysis, bootstrap sampling, and the ANOVA statistical significance test. Both approaches outperform the diagnosis decisions of the physicians. Hence, both systems have the potential to reduce the number of unnecessary breast biopsies in clinical practice. A comparison of the performance of the proposed decision tree and CBR approaches with a state of the art approach based on artificial neural networks (ANN) shows that the CBR approach performs slightly better than the ANN approach, which in turn results in slightly better performance than the decision-tree approach. The differences are statistically significant (p value < 0.001). On 2100 masses extracted from the DDSM database, the CRB approach for example resulted in an area under the ROC curve of A(z) = 0.89 +/- 0.01, the decision-tree approach in A(z) = 0.87 +/- 0.01, and the ANN approach in A(z) = 0.88 +/- 0.01.

PURPOSE: Reduction of radiation exposure at an adequate image quality by optimizing the radiation quality for a new system of full-field digital mammography using a digital detector (a-Se). MATERIALS AND METHODS: The investigations were performed using a digital mammography system Novation (Siemens, Erlangen). The system was constructed with a bimetal anode (molybdenum and tungsten) and the possibility of changing the filter (molybdenum/rhodium). The test object was the Wisconsin Mammography Random Phantom Model 152 A (Radiation Measurements Inc.) of which images were acquired using the digital technique with the tungsten anode and rhodium filter at different tube voltages (26-35 kV) and tube loads (40-100 mAs) and compared to images in the molybdan/molybdan molybdenum/molybdenum technique. To quantify the image quality, we used the detection rate of the simulated lesions in the phantom. RESULTS: Increasing the tube voltage significantly decreases the average glandular dose when using AEC (Automatic Exposure Control), i. e., constant detector dose. At the same time, the image quality decreases significantly with respect to the detection rate (26 kV, 1 mGy, 95.1 %; 35 kV, 0.7 mGy, 82.7 %). As a good compromise between the necessary diagnostic image quality and the lowest dose exposition, 28 kV and 60 mAs were selected for imaging with the tungsten/rhodium anode/filter combination. A further change to the tube load did not make sense because a decrease of 10 % resulted in a significant decrease in the detection rate while only a 2 % increase in detection rate was achieved for a 65 % increase in radiation exposure. CONCLUSION: The results of this phantom study demonstrate that the routine use of the tungsten anode in combination with a rhodium filter for full-field digital mammography with an a-Se detector in contrast to a molybdan/molybdan molybdenum/molybdenum anode/filter combination results in a reduction of the average glandular dose of up to 30 % without loss of diagnostic image quality.

PURPOSE: Evaluation of the diagnostic value of breast specimen imaging with a digital mammographic system using a detector system with changeable pixel size compared to standard mode imaging in different monitor display modes. MATERIALS AND METHODS: Using the digital mammographic system SenoScan (Fischer Imaging, Denver, USA), 50 diagnostic breast specimens with microcalcifications were visualized in both standard mode (pixel size 54 microm) and high resolution mode (pixel size 27 microm). The resulting radiographs were displayed 1:1 on a monitor. Standard mode images (pixel size 54 microm) were additionally displayed in a 2:1 mode. A total of 5 readers with different mammographic experience analyzed the type of the microcalcifications on the basis of the different display modes. The images were presented randomly. The findings were subsequently compared to the histology. RESULTS: The high resolution mode yielded slightly but not significantly better results than the standard mode on average for all 5 readers. Compared to a sensitivity of 80 % and a specificity of 72 % (PPV = 74 %, NPV = 78 %) in the standard mode, the high resolution mode provided a sensitivity of 86 % and a specificity of 74 % (PPV = 77 %, NPV = 83 %). The standard mode images on a 2:1 monitor display yielded 84 % and 74 % (PPV = 76 %, NPV = 82 %). CONCLUSION: The high resolution mode did not significantly increase the sensitivity and specificity of the microcalcification reading. A similar improvement was achieved by the 2:1 display mode, i. e. digital monitor zooming. For the clinical situation this means that there is no diagnostic advantage from using a high resolution target view with this mammographic system.

Introduction The placement of intramammary marker clips has proven to be helpful for tumor localization in patients undergoing neoadjuvant chemotherapy and breast-conserving surgery. The purpose of our study was to investigate the feasibility of using a clip marker system for breast cancer localization and its influence on the imaging assessment of treatment responses after neoadjuvant chemotherapy. Patients and Methods Between March and June 2015, a total of 25 patients (n = 25), with a suspicion of invasive breast cancer with diameters of at least 2 cm (cT2), underwent preoperative sonographically guided core needle biopsy using a single-use breast biopsy system (HistoCore™) and intramammary clip marking using a directly adapted clip system based on the established O-Twist Marker™, before their scheduled preoperative neoadjuvant chemotherapy. Localization of the intramammary marker clip was controlled by sonography and digital breast tomosynthesis. Results Sonography detected no dislocation of intrammammary marker clips in 20 of 25 patients (80 %), while digital breast tomosynthesis showed accurate placement without dislocation in 24 patients (96 %) (p < 0.05). There was no evidence of significant clip migration during preoperative follow-up imaging after neoadjuvant chemotherapy. No complication related to the clip marking was noted and there was no difficulty in evaluating the treatment response to neoadjuvant chemotherapy. Among the breast-conserving surgeries performed, no cases were identified in which intraoperative loss of the marker clip had occurred. Conclusion Our study underscores the importance of intramammary marking clip systems before neoadjuvant chemotherapy. Placement of marker clips is advised to facilitate accurate tumor bed localization. With regard to digital breast tomosynthesis, its development continues to improve the quality of diagnostics and the therapy of breast cancer particularly for small breast cancer tumors or in neoadjuvant chemotherapy setting.

PURPOSE: To compare the sensitivity of conventional two-dimensional (2D) projection imaging with tomosynthesis with respect to the detectability of mammographic phantom lesions. MATERIALS AND METHODS: Using a breast tomosynthesis prototype based on a commercial FFDM system (Siemens MAMMOMAT Novation), but modified for a wide angle tube motion and equipped with a fast read-out amorphous selenium detector, we acquired standard 2D images and tomosynthesis series of projection views. We used the Wisconsin mammographic random phantom, model RMI 152A. The anode filter combinations Mo/Mo and W/Rh at two different doses were used as typical radiographic techniques. Slice images through the phantom parallel to the detector were reconstructed with a distance of 1 mm employing a filtered back-projection algorithm. The image data sets were read by five radiologists and evaluated with respect to the detectability of the phantom details. RESULTS: For all studied radiographic techniques, the detection rate in the tomosynthesis mode was 100 %, i. e. 75 true positive findings out of 75 possible hits. In contrast, the conventional projection mode yielded a detection rate between 80 and 93 % (corresponding to 60 and 70 detected details) depending on the dose and X-ray spectrum. CONCLUSION: Tomosynthesis has the potential to increase the sensitivity of digital mammography. Overlapping structures from out-of-plane tissue can be removed in the tomosynthesis reconstruction process, thereby enhancing the diagnostic accuracy.

Introduction: Stereotactically-guided core needle biopsies (CNB) of breast tumours allow histological examination of the tumour without surgery. Touch imprint cytology (TIC) of CNB promises to be useful in providing same-day diagnosis for counselling purposes and for planning future surgery. Having addressed the issue of accuracy of immediate microscopic evaluation of TIC, we wanted to re-examine the usefulness of this procedure in light of the present health care climate of cost containment by incorporating the surgical 15-year follow-up data and outcome. Patients and Methods: From January until December 1996 we performed TIC in core needle biopsies of 173 breast tumours in 169 patients, consisting of 122 malignant and 51 benign tumours. Histology of core needle biopsies was proven by surgical histology in all malignant and in 5 benign tumours. Surgical breast biopsy was not performed in 46 patients with 46 benign lesions, as the histological result from the core needle biopsy and the result of the TIC were in agreement with the suspected diagnosis from the complementary breast diagnostics. A 15-year follow-up of these patients followed in 2013 and follow-up data was collected from 40 women. Results: In the 15-year follow-up of the 40 benign lesions primarily confirmed using CNB and TIC, a diagnostic sensitivity, specificity, positive and negative predictive value and accuracy of 100 % was found. Conclusion: TIC and stereotactically guided CNB showed excellent long-term follow-up in patients with benign breast lesions. The use of TIC to complement CNB can therefore provide immediate cytological diagnosis of breast lesions.

BACKGROUND: To improve breast cancer treatment, the evaluation of predictive factors is in the focus of clinical research. Significant discrepancies between the clinical assessment of response to neoadjuvant chemotherapy (NACT) and the pathological assessment of response from post-therapy surgical specimens have been demonstrated. We focused on comparing the value of various diagnostic methods used in medical routine. PATIENTS AND METHODS: A clinical evaluation of the primary tumour and regional lymph nodes before and after NACT was performed in 139 patients by physical examination, sonography and mammography. RESULTS: Mammography and physical examination correlated best with pathological findings in the measurement of the tumour, whereas sonography was the most accurate predictor of the status for axillary lymph nodes. CONCLUSION: Mammography and physical examination are the best non-invasive predictors of the real size of the primary breast cancer, whereas sonography correlates better with the proven status of axillary lymph nodes.

PURPOSE: The NMR-MOUSE is an open and mobile sensor for measuring NMR relaxation parameters in organic matters. T1-measurements of the subcutaneous fatty tissue and the skin are reported. MATERIAL AND METHOD: For the first time, the NMR-MOUSE was employed to measure the signal recovery following saturation of the skin and the subcutaneous fatty tissue of three patients, before and after administering a contrast agent. RESULTS: Despite a low signal-to-noise ratio, changes in the relaxation behaviour of the skin could be detected. Malignant tissue exhibits faster signal recovery than scar tissue and healthy tissue, which only show a small difference. CONCLUSIONS: Changes in the relaxation behavior can be monitored with the NMR-MOUSE. Before the clinical use of the NMR-MOUSE, sensitivity, sensor mounting device, and sensor tuning must be improved. Further investigations need to be performed on a statistically relevant number of patients.

PURPOSE: To determine the diagnostic accuracy of microcalcifications and focal lesions in a retrospective clinical-histological study using high-resolution digital phosphor storage plates (hard copy) and full-field digital mammography (hard copy). MATERIALS AND METHODS: From May 2003 to September 2003, 102 patients underwent digital storage plate mammography (CR), using a mammography unit (Mammomat 3000 N, Siemens) in combination with a high resolution (9 lp/mm) digital storage phosphor plate system (pixel size 50 microm) (Fuji/Siemens). After diagnosis and preoperative wire localization, full-field digital mammography (CCD) (DR) was performed with the same exposure parameters. The full-field digital mammography used a CCD-detector (SenoScan) (Fisher Imaging) with a resolution of 10 Ip/mm and a pixel size of 50 microm. Five investigators determined the diagnosis (BI-RADS I - V) retrospectively after the operation from randomly distributed mediolateral views (hard copy reading). These results were correlated with the final histology. RESULTS: The diagnostic accuracy of digital storage plate mammography (CR) and full-field digital mammography (CCD) (DR) was 73 % and 71 % for all findings (n = 102), 73 % and 71 % for microcalcifications (n = 51), and 72 % and 70 % for focal lesions (n = 51). The overall results showed no difference. CONCLUSION: Our findings indicate the equivalence of high-resolution digital phosphor storage plate mammography (CR) and full-field digital mammography (CCD) (DR).
